1. 首页 > 数据库 > 正文

安装MySQL开发环境的详细教程:从零开始搭建数据库

MySQL作为全球最流行的开源关系型数据库管理系统,以其稳定性、高性能和易用性成为开发者的首选。本文,AI部落将为您提供一份从零开始搭建MySQL开发环境的详细指南,请参考。

安装MySQL开发环境的详细教程:从零开始搭建数据库

准备工作

在开始安装之前,请确保您的系统满足以下基本要求:

  • 操作系统:Windows 10/11、macOS或Linux(本教程以Ubuntu 20.04为例)

  • 内存:至少2GB RAM(4GB以上为佳)

  • 存储空间:至少2GB可用空间

  • 网络连接:用于下载安装包

如果您希望在云环境中部署,可以考虑使用PetaCloud的服务。PetaCloud提供稳定、高性价比的全球云服务能力,能简化上云流程,消除技术复杂性,无论是个人项目还是企业级应用,都能快速获得可靠的云服务器资源。

步骤一:下载MySQL安装包

Windows系统

  1. 访问MySQL官方网站

  2. 选择MySQL Community Server版本

  3. 根据系统架构(32位或64位)下载相应的安装程序

  4. 建议下载体积较小的“MySQL Installer”进行安装管理

macOS系统

安装MySQL开发环境的详细教程

Linux系统(Ubuntu示例)

安装MySQL开发环境的详细教程

步骤二:安装MySQL

Windows详细安装过程

  1. 运行下载的MySQL Installer

  2. 选择“Custom”自定义安装类型

  3. 在左侧选择MySQL Server,添加到右侧安装列表

  4. 点击“Execute”开始安装

  5. 安装完成后进入配置向导

Linux系统配置

安装MySQL开发环境的详细教程

安全安装脚本会引导您完成以下重要设置:

  • 设置root用户密码

  • 移除匿名用户

  • 禁止root远程登录

  • 移除测试数据库

  • 重新加载权限表

步骤三:基础配置与验证

登录MySQL

安装MySQL开发环境的详细教程

基本配置调整

编辑MySQL配置文件,根据您的需求进行调整:

安装MySQL开发环境的详细教程

创建测试数据库和用户

安装MySQL开发环境的详细教程

步骤四:安装图形化管理工具(可选)

为了提高开发效率,建议安装图形化管理工具:

推荐工具

  1. MySQL Workbench(官方工具)

    • 功能全面,支持数据库设计、SQL开发等

    • 适合中高级开发者

  2. phpMyAdmin(Web界面)

    安装MySQL开发环境的详细教程
  3. DBeaver(开源免费)

    • 支持多种数据库

    • 界面友好,适合初学者

步骤五:连接测试与验证

测试本地连接

安装MySQL开发环境的详细教程

验证安装完整性

安装MySQL开发环境的详细教程

云环境部署建议

对于需要更高可用性、可扩展性的项目,建议考虑云数据库解决方案。PetaCloud提供的MySQL云服务具备以下优势:

  1. 一键部署:简化上云流程,几分钟内即可获得生产级数据库环境

  2. 自动备份:确保数据安全,支持时间点恢复

  3. 弹性扩展:根据业务需求动态调整资源配置,助力业务快速增长

  4. 全球可用:多个数据中心选择,确保低延迟访问

  5. 成本优化:高性价比的计费方案,避免资源浪费

使用云服务不仅能减少运维负担,还能让您更专注于业务逻辑开发。PetaCloud的技术支持团队能帮助消除技术复杂性,即使是数据库新手也能快速上手。

总结

通过本教程,您已经成功搭建了MySQL开发环境。从本地安装到基础配置,您现在已经具备了开始数据库开发的基础。无论是简单的个人项目还是复杂的企业应用,MySQL都能提供可靠的数据存储解决方案。

AI部落温馨提示:以上是对安装MySQL开发环境的详细教程:从零开始搭建数据库的介绍,点击PetaCloud官网,了解PetaCloud虚拟机,释放云计算无线可能!

本文由网上采集发布,不代表我们立场,转载联系作者并注明出处:https://www.aijto.com/11935.html

联系我们

在线咨询:点击这里给我发消息

微信号:13180206953

工作日:9:30-18:30,节假日休息